Game Balls

Taylor Martin rushed for 43 yards and sprinted 45 yards for a touchdown reception.

Carter Stanley completed 9 of 11 passes for 127 yards and two touchdowns, threw one interception and rushed for 34 yards.

Gassers

Mike Lee was flagged for a taunting penalty on KU’s opening kickoff into the end zone. If you can’t taunt when your kicker booms one, when can you?

Daniel Wise was ejected for a flagrant personal foul. As he waved to the taunting West Virginia fans before running into the tunnel, getting a head start on Iowa State game preparation, a thought occurred to an observer: He really does move well for such a big man.

WEST VIRGINIA 33, KANSAS 14

Box score

Game Balls

JaCorey Shepherd broke up three passes and averaged 24.5 yards per kickoff return. Shepherd repeatedly took long test after long test and passed them.

Nigel King had four receptions for 52 yards and was overthrown repeatedly. He dropped one pass, but overall had a strong day.

Gassers

Andrew Bolton was flagged for roughing the passer on a play in which all the Mountaineers receivers were covered and quarterback Clint Trickett was trying to throw the ball away.

Montell Cozart still hasn’t made any progress and was benched after a first half in which he completed 4 of 10 passes for 42 yards.
